What is a business process professional?

Business process professionals are individuals who analyze, design, implement, and optimize organizational processes to improve efficiency, productivity, and quality. They often work to identify bottlenecks, recommend solutions, and help organizations adapt to changing business needs. Their work may involve mapping workflows, integrating technology, and collaborating with various departments to ensure smooth operations. Business process professionals can work in a variety of industries, including finance, healthcare, manufacturing, and IT.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a business process analyst,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Business Process Analyst, you need strong analytical skills, process mapping expertise, and a background in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Microsoft Visio, BPMN software, and data analysis platforms, as well as certifications such as Six Sigma or Lean, are commonly required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and stakeholder management are the soft skills that set top performers apart in this role. These skills are crucial for identifying inefficiencies, driving continuous improvement, and ensuring organizational processes align with business goals.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in business process roles?

Professionals in Business Process roles often encounter challenges such as identifying inefficiencies in existing workflows, driving cross-departmental collaboration, and managing resistance to organizational change. These roles require balancing analytical tasks with strong communication skills, as you’ll frequently present process improvements to both technical and non-technical stakeholders. Adapting to fast-paced environments and continuously learning new process management tools are also typical aspects of the job, making flexibility and a growth mindset important for success.

What is the difference between Business Process vs Business Analyst?

AspectBusiness ProcessBusiness Analyst
Primary FocusDesigning, analyzing, and improving workflows and proceduresGathering requirements, analyzing business needs, and recommending solutions
Required SkillsProcess mapping, workflow analysis, problem-solvingCommunication, data analysis, stakeholder management
Work EnvironmentOperations, process improvement teams, consultingProject teams, IT departments, business units
CertificationsLean, Six Sigma, BPM certificationsCBAP, CCBA, PMI-PBA

Business Process professionals focus on designing and optimizing workflows within organizations, while Business Analysts gather requirements and analyze business needs to recommend solutions. Both roles often collaborate but serve different functions in process improvement and project implementation.
